Description

Vinyl Lithium is a highly reactive organolithium compound, widely recognized as a versatile reagent for introducing a vinyl group into organic molecules. Its significance lies in its role as a powerful nucleophile and strong base, enabling critical carbon-carbon bond formation in complex synthetic pathways. This compound is essential for R&D chemists and process engineers in the pharmaceutical, agrochemical, and advanced materials sectors, where it is used to construct key molecular frameworks.

Application

  • Pharmaceutical Intermediate Synthesis: A key building block for creating vinyl-substituted active pharmaceutical ingredients (APIs) and complex chiral molecules.
  • Agrochemical Manufacturing: Used in the synthesis of herbicides, fungicides, and insecticides that require a vinyl functional group for bioactivity.
  • Polymer & Material Science: Serves as an initiator or monomer in the development of specialized polymers, elastomers, and functionalized materials.
  • Fine Chemical Production: Employed in the synthesis of flavors, fragrances, and other high-value specialty chemicals.
  • Cross-Coupling Reactions: A crucial reagent in Negishi, Kumada, and other transition metal-catalyzed cross-coupling reactions to form styrene derivatives.
  • Academic & Industrial R&D: A fundamental tool in research laboratories for methodological development and exploring new synthetic routes.

Basic Information

Product Name Vinyl Lithium
CAS No. 917-57-7
Molecular Formula C2H3Li
Molecular Weight 33.98 g/mol
Synonyms Ethenyllithium; Lithium ethenide; Vinyl lithium solution; Lithium vinyl; Ethenyl lithium; Vinyllithium; LiCH=CH2
EINECS 213-027-4

Storage

Preserve in a tightly closed container, protected from light. Due to its properties as a strong base/organic solvent, highly volatile, and easily oxidized nature, this material must be stored under an inert atmosphere (argon or nitrogen) at recommended temperatures, typically between 2°C and 8°C for solutions. Store in a cool, dry, well-ventilated area away from incompatible materials.
